Adafruit Universal Thermocouple Amplifier MAX31856 Breakout
The Adafruit Universal Thermocouple Amplifier MAX31856 Breakout reads temperature from virtually any thermocouple type — K, J, N, R, S, T, E, or B — with 0.0078125°C resolution and a measurement range of -210°C to +1800°C. It handles cold-junction compensation, linearisation, and fault detection ...
Thermocouple Type-K Glass Braid Insulated Stainless Steel Tip
Thermocouples are best used for measuring temperatures that can go above 100°C. This is a bare wires stainless-steel tip probe which can measure air or surface temperatures. Most inexpensive thermocouples have a vinyl covering which can melt at around 200°C, this one uses a fiberglass braid so...

Thermocouple Amplifier with 1-Wire Breakout Board - MAX31850K
The MAX31850K breakout board is a 1-Wire thermocouple amplifier with cold-junction compensation for K-type thermocouples. Unlike SPI-based amplifiers, the 1-Wire interface allows any number of thermocouple breakouts to share a single data line — ideal for multi-point temperature measurement. The...
